31,480,256 (thirty-one million four hundred eighty thousand two hundred fifty-six) is an even 8-digit number. It is a composite number with 28 divisors, and factors as 2⁶ × 107 × 4,597. Its proper divisors sum to 31,585,912,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E059C0.
